The situation this course is for
In regulated industries, resilience is often managed in isolation, compliance here, operations there, IT security somewhere else. This fragmentation creates inefficiencies, increases audit risk, and slows incident response. When teams don’t share a common framework, alignment breaks down just when it’s needed most.
